This is a fully remote position, open to applicants in Germany.
• Develop and sustain annual and rolling financial forecasts (revenue, expenses, cash flow, headcount) for the organization.
• Convert company-wide objectives into departmental budgets and commercial targets, collaborating with department leaders to establish and monitor them.
• Track actuals against budget and projections; identify variances promptly and suggest corrective measures.
• Generate regular reports for the CEO and, when necessary, for investors/board — including KPIs, burn rate, runway, and unit economics.
• Assist in fundraising activities by preparing financial models, data rooms, and investor reporting as required.
• Oversee the entire billing and invoicing process for clients, including resolving issues and managing collections.
• Administer accounts receivable and payable, while monitoring cash flow and runway.
• Establish and enhance billing systems/processes as the organization grows.
• Execute monthly payroll (either directly or through a payroll service), ensuring accuracy and compliance with German and international employment and tax regulations.
• Maintain compensation structures and assist in salary benchmarking and negotiations for new hires, in collaboration with the CEO and hiring managers.
• Serve as the primary liaison with our external tax advisors (Steuerberater) and accountants concerning German tax returns, VAT filings, and annual financial statements.
• Ensure adherence to German GAAP (HGB) and pertinent statutory/regulatory obligations.
• Oversee bookkeeping and month-end closing, collaborating with external accounting support where necessary.
• Maintain internal financial controls, policies, and readiness for audits as the company expands.
• Establish scalable finance processes, tools, and systems suitable for a small but growing team.
• Provide guidance to the CEO and leadership team on financial strategy, pricing, and resource allocation.
• Experience in FP&A, finance management, or a comparable broad finance role — startup experience (preferably Series A/B) is advantageous.
• Strong understanding of German tax and finance regulations (HGB, VAT/Umsatzsteuer, payroll compliance) and experience collaborating with a Steuerberater or similar professional.
• Practical experience with billing/invoicing and payroll, beyond just budgeting and reporting.
• Excellent financial modeling and proficiency in Excel/Sheets; ability to create projections and budgets from the ground up.
• Fluent in German and possess professional working proficiency in English.
• Comfortable navigating the uncertainties of a startup: eager to develop processes and tools rather than inherit them, and willing to be hands-on rather than solely strategic.
• Bonus: experience with startup finance/payroll tools, and familiarity with fundraising or investor reporting.
